CALICHE is the annual Applied Linguistics graduate student conference on the teaching and learning of second languages organized by the Graduate Society of Applied Linguistics (GSAL) in the Department of Classical and Modern Languages and Literatures at Texas Tech University. This conference, held since 2012, includes presentations and poster sessions chosen through a peer review process. Participants come from various parts of Texas and surrounding states.

This is a satellite workshop for the 6th Phonetics and Phonology in Europe (PaPE) conference to be held in Palma, Spain.
We plan to discuss various phonetic and phonological processes stemming from or leading to the instability of acoustic cues for realising segmental contrasts.
